Trainee Clinical Pharmaceutical Scientist
-
Sep 2013 - Sep 2016
Comprehensive training in areas of Technical and Clinical Pharmaceutical Science including Radiopharmacy, Quality Assurance, Aseptic Processing and Large Scale Batch Manufacture.The role has required me to rotate around multiple departments within NHS Hospitals and meet learning objectives that are recorded and reviewed using an Online Learning and Assessment Tool (OLAT).
